Munchilicious Granola - Dried Fruits in 40gms pack

Munchilicious Granola, a Soch Foods product, has introduced easy to whip-up granola variants in 40g packs. According to the company, with our daily routine moving towards the new normal, these healthy granola packs will make up for deliciously satisfying breakfast and snacking options for our modern-day health-conscious consumers. The new packing’s of Munchilicious Granola is available in four currently-existing variants, namely original, dried fruits, desi-twist, and grain-free.

Munchilicious is a brand of Soch Foods that aims to usher in a healthy food lifestyle in general and particularly for the new-age, health-conscious, and time-starved working professionals. Over a short period, Munchilicious has made its way to leading retail platforms across India, such as Nature’s Basket, Spencers, Amazon, Flipkart, and many more. Presently, Munchilicious Granola is available in the popular variants of dried fruits, original, grain-free, desi-twist, and dark chocolate.

Consumers can enjoy Munchilicious Granola directly out of the box and also with milk, ice-cream, yogurt, smoothies, and protein shakes, amongst others. All Munchilicious products are tested in Asia’s trusted and well-known Lab TUV SUD and are ISO 22000 certified. Purvi Pugalia, the co-promoter of Soch Foods, is the master chef of Munchilicious Granola, who supervises the brand’s taste and quality aspects.
